What to Expect at the Festival
The Brisbane Afrobeats Festival 2026 will showcase the infectious rhythms and contemporary sounds that have taken the global music scene by storm. Attendees can expect a carefully curated lineup featuring both international Afrobeats superstars and Australia's rising African artists, creating a unique fusion of global and local talent.
The festival will feature multiple stages, each offering different experiences from intimate acoustic sets to high-energy dance performances. Beyond the main musical acts, the event will incorporate traditional African drumming workshops, dance classes, and cultural exhibitions that celebrate the rich heritage behind the Afrobeats movement.
More Than Just Music
The festival extends far beyond musical performances, creating an immersive cultural experience. Food vendors will serve authentic African cuisine, from Nigerian jollof rice to Ethiopian injera, while local artisans will showcase traditional crafts and contemporary African art.
- Interactive workshops on African percussion and dance
- Fashion showcases featuring African-inspired designers
- Children's activities including storytelling sessions
- Community discussions on African culture in Australia
